What companies run services between San Diego, CA, USA and Grand Canyon South Rim, AZ, USA?

There is no direct connection from San Diego to Grand Canyon South Rim. However, you can fly to Flagstaff (FLG), walk to Flagstaff Pulliam Airport, take the bus to Grand Canyon Maswik Lodge, take the bus to Village East, then walk to Grand Canyon South Rim. Alternatively, you can take the bus to Los Angeles Union Station, take the bus to Williams, then take the taxi to Grand Canyon South Rim.
